Planning Your Visit

Timing Your Visit for Salmon

The Leavenworth National Fish Hatchery is most exciting during salmon migration seasons. While you can see fish year-round, witnessing the salmon return to spawn offers a unique spectacle. Check local reports for peak migration times to maximize your experience.

Self-Guided Exploration

Most of the Leavenworth National Fish Hatchery experience is self-guided. Grab a leaflet from the visitor center to learn about the salmon life cycle and local wildlife. It's a great way to explore at your own pace.

"It's 3 in 1 - a national fish hatchery, small museum of local wildlife in the area and finally it's a great place for doing hikes around the creek and such.

There were porta potties outside available. Plus bathrooms and drinking water in the office/museum.

The hatchery was closed when we visited but they left everything open for viewing. We parked on the road outside the signs and walked in.

Worth a visit for sure!"

Tim Traveler

"The hatchery is located about 5 mins drive away from downtown Leavenworth. It is basically a self guided tour, so remember to grab the leaflet located in the visitor center.

As it's free, it's something to do if you have the time to go and have a quick look around. It provides good information on the life cycle of the salmon."

Marilyn Mok

"Stumbled upon this cool hatchery in early November. It’s pretty astounding that king salmon swim 200 miles up the Colombia river to get here."
